2022虚拟语气练习题.docx
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_05.gif)
《2022虚拟语气练习题.docx》由会员分享,可在线阅读,更多相关《2022虚拟语气练习题.docx(39页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、2022虚拟语气练习题篇一:虚拟语气经典练习题库(附详细解答) 虚拟语气练习题 1.I enjoyed the movie very much. I wish I _ the book from which it was made. A. have readB. had read C. should have read D. are reading 2.You are late. If you _ a few minutes earlier, you _ him. A. come; would meet B. had come; would have met C. come; will mee
2、tD. had come; would meet 3.The two students talked as if they _ friends for years. A. should beB. would be C. have beenD. had been 4.It is important that I _ with Mr. Williams immediately. A. speak B. spoke C. will speak D. to speak 5.He looked as if he _ ill for a long time. A. wasB. were C. has be
3、enD. had been 6.If the doctor had come earlier, the poor child would not _. A. have laid there for two hours B. have been lied there for two hours C. have lied there for two hours D. have lain there for two hours 7.I wish that I _ with you last night. A. wentB. could go C. have goneD. could have gon
4、e 8.Lets say you could go there again, how _ feel? A. will you B. should you C. would you D. do you 9.I cant stand him. He always talks as though he _ everything. A. knewB. knows C. has knownD. had known 10._ the fog, we should have reached our school. A. Because ofB. In spite of C. In case ofD. But
5、 for 11.If you had told me in advance, I _ him at the airport. A. would meet B. would had met C. would have met D. would have meet 12.Mike can take his car apart and put it back together again. I certainly wish he_ me how. A. teaches B. will teach C. has taught D. would teach 13.I would have told hi
6、m the answer had it been possible, but I _ so busy then. A. had been B. were C. was D. would be 14.Hes working hard for fear that he _. A. should fall behind B. fell behind C. may fall behindD. would fallen behind 15.If it _ another ten minutes, the game would have been called off. A. had rained B.
7、would have rained C. have seenD. rained 16.He suggested that they _ use a trick instead of fighting. A. should B. would C. do D. had 17.My father did not go to New York; the doctor suggested that he _ there. A. not wentB. wont go C. not go D. not to go 18.I would have gone to the meeting if I _ time
8、. A. had hadB. have had C. had D. would have had 19.Would you rather I _ buying a new bike? A. decided againstB. will decide against C. have decided D. shall decide against 20.You look so tired tonight. It is time you _. A. go to sleep B. went to sleep C. go to bed D. went to bed 21.Why didnt you bu
9、y a new car? I would have bought one if I _ enough money. A. had B. have had C. would have D. had had 22.If she could sew, _. A. she make a dress B. she would have made a shirt C. she will make a shirt D. she would had made a coat 23._ today, he would get there by Friday. A. Would he leave B. Was he
10、 leaving C. Were he to leave D. If he leaves 24.His doctor suggested that he _ a short trip abroad. A. will take B. would take C. take D. took 25.The Bakers arrived last night. If theyd only let us know earlier,_ at the station. A. wed meet them B. well meet them C. wed have met them D. weve met the
11、m 26.If I _ you, I _ more attention to English idioms and phrases. A. was; shall payB. am; will pay C. would be; would payD. were; would pay 27.We might have failed if you _ us a helping hand. A. have not given B. would not give C. had not givenD. did not give 28.The law requires that everyone _ his
12、 car checked at least once a year. A. has B. had C. haveD. will have 29.It is strange that he _ so. A. would sayB. would speak C. should say D. will speak 30.Had I known her name, _ A. or does she know mine?B. and where does she live? C. she would be beautiful.D. I would have invited her to lunch. 3
13、1.He has just arrived, but he talks as if he _ all about that. A. know B. knows C. knownD. knew 32.If I _ the money, I would have bought a much bigger car. A. possessed B. owned C. had D. had had 33.He was very busy yesterday; otherwise, he _ to the meeting. A. would come B. came C. would have come
14、D. will come 34.The librarian insists that John _ no more books from the library before he returns all the books he has borrowed. A. will take B. took C. take D. takes 35.I left very early last night, but I wish I _ so early. A. didnt leave B. hadnt left C. havent left D. couldnt leave 36.I do not h
15、ave a job. I would find one but I _ no time. A. had B. didnt have C. had had D. have 37.I wish that you _ such a bad headache because Im sure that you would have enjoyed the concert. A. hadntB. didnt have had C. hadnt had D. hadnt have 38.He insisted that we all _ in his office at one oclock. A. be
16、B. to be C. would be D. shall be 39.Helen couldnt go to France after all. Thats too bad. Im sure she would have enjoyed it if _. A. shes gone B. shell go C. shed gone D. shed go 40.I must go there earlier. John has suggested that I _ an hour before the discussion begins. A. goB. shall go C. will goD
17、. would go 15 BBDAD 610 DDCAD 1115 CDCAA 1620 ACAAD 2125 DBCCC2630 DCCCD 3135 DDCCB3640 DCACD 解析: 1.wish后面用虚拟语气,表示与过去事实相反用过去完成时。 2.条件句表示与过去事实相反,主句用过去将来完成时,从句用过去完成时。 3.as if后面如果表示真实情况就不用虚拟。 4.It is important that是主语从句的虚拟语气,从句用sb. should do的形式。 5.as if后面是真实情况,不虚拟。 6.lain是lie的过去分词,表示“躺”。 7.could have d
18、one表示“本来可以”。 8.与将来相反的虚拟语气,主句用过去将来时。 9.as if表示不可能发生的事情时用虚拟语气。 10.but for表示“要不是的话”,通常与虚拟语气搭配使用。 11.in advance表示“事先”,表示与过去事实相反的虚拟语气。 12.wish的宾语从句表示发生在将来的愿望用过去将来时。 13.but的并列句表示真实情况,不用虚拟语气。 14.for fear that后面的状语从句用sb. should do的形式。 15.表示与过去事实相反,主句用过去将来完成时,从句用过去完成时。 16.suggest后面的宾语从句用sb. should do的形式。 17.
19、suggest后面的从句用sb. should do的形式,should可以省略。 18.表示与过去事实相反,从句用过去完成时。 19.would rather的宾语从句用sb. did的形式。 20.It is time后面的定语从句用sb. did的形式。 21.第一个had是过去完成时,第二个had表示“有”。 22.would have done是过去将来完成时,表示与过去相反的虚拟语气。 23.这是虚拟语气的倒装形式,把if去掉,助动词提前。 24.suggest后面的从句用sb. should do的形式,should可以省略。 25.表示与过去事实相反,主句用过去将来完成时。 2
20、6.在虚拟语气中,不管什么人称,be动词都要用were的形式。 27.表示与过去事实相反,从句用过去完成时。 28.require后面的从句用sb. should do的形式,should可以省略。 29.It is strange that是主语从句的虚拟语气,从句用sb. should do的形式。 30.had I known是与过去相反的虚拟语气的倒装形式。 31.as if表示不可能发生的事情时用虚拟语气。 32.第一个had是过去完成时,第二个had表示“有”。 33.otherwise经常可以搭配虚拟语气,表示与过去事实相反。 34.当insist表示“坚持认为”时不用虚拟形式。
21、 35.wish后面用虚拟语气,表示与过去事实相反用过去完成时。 36.but的并列句表示真实情况,不用虚拟语气。 37.wish后面用虚拟语气,表示与过去事实相反用过去完成时。 38.当insist表示“坚持要求”时从句用虚拟形式。 39.表示与过去事实相反,从句用过去完成时。 40.suggest后面的从句用sb. should do的形式,should可以省略。 篇二:虚拟语气的用法及经典练习题(附答案) 虚拟语气概念虚拟语气用来表示说话人的主观愿望或假想,而不表示客观存在的事实,所说的是一个条件,不一定是事实,或与事实相反。虚拟语气通 过谓语动词的特殊形式来表示。英语中的语气分为陈述语
22、气、祈使语气、虚拟语气三类。应用条件 在表示虚假的、与事实相反的或难以实现的情况时用虚拟语气,表示主观愿望或某种强 烈情感时,也用虚拟语气。即当一个人 说话时欲强调其所说的话是基于自己的主观想法,而不是根据客观实际,就用虚拟语气。 在非真实条件状语从句中的用法 真实条件状语从句与非真实条件状语从句 条件句可分为两类,一类为真实条件句,一类为非真实条件句。非真实条件句表示的是假设或实际可能性不大的情况,故 采用虚拟语气。 例: If he doesnt hurry up, he will miss the bus. 如果他不快点,他将错过巴士。 ( 真实 ) If he is free, he
23、will ask me to tell stories. 如果他是空闲的,他会要求我讲故事。 (真实) If I were you, I would go at once. 如果我是你,我马上就会去。 (非真实,虚拟语气) If there were no air, people would die. 如果没有空气,人就会死亡。 (非真实,虚拟语气) 用法及动词形式从句主句If+ 主语 +did 与现在事实相反 ( be 动 词 were )主语 +should/would/ could/might+do主语 +should/would/ 与过去事实相反 If+ 主语 +had done co
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 2022 虚拟 语气 练习题
![提示](https://www.taowenge.com/images/bang_tan.gif)
限制150内